Why Starting Small Can Lead to Big Investment wins

When you kick off your investment journey,‍ thinking ⁢big might seem tempting but starting small ofen creates a​ stronger foundation. Small investments allow you to test ‌the‌ waters without risking too⁢ much ⁢upfront. By beginning with modest sums,you can learn how markets ‍move,discover ‌your risk tolerance,and get agreeable ‌with your strategy. Plus, small wins build confidence and can encourage consistency—two key ⁤ingredients for long-term success.

  • Flexibility: ⁢Easier to​ adapt strategies if you start small.
  • Lower pressure: Less stress over each​ investment decision.
  • Compound growth: ⁢ Even tiny‍ amounts grow substantially over time.
Investment Size Potential Benefit Risk Level
Under​ $500 Learn without spending much Low
$500 – $1,000 Start building a portfolio Moderate
Over $1,000 Higher early ⁤returns Higher

Picking the Right Mix: How to Balance Your Portfolio Like⁣ a ​Pro

Creating a ​solid investment portfolio‌ isn’t just about picking⁢ trendy stocks or chasing high returns—it’s about mixing different assets in a way that fits your personal goals and risk tolerance. Think of it ‍like crafting the perfect playlist: a little ⁢rock, some jazz, and yes, a sprinkle of classical to keep things balanced.Start by diversifying across ⁢various asset classes such as stocks, bonds, ‍and even alternative investments to cushion against market swings. Remember, your ‌portfolio’s‍ mix should​ evolve as your life changes—what’s right for a 25-year-old might be too risky for ‍someone nearing retirement.

To make your life easier, here’s a quick​ cheat sheet you can customize based on your ⁤style:

  • Conservative: 20% stocks, 60% bonds, ‍20% cash⁤ or equivalents
  • Balanced: ⁤50% stocks, 40% bonds, 10% cash or alternatives
  • Aggressive: 80% stocks, 15% bonds, 5% alternatives
Risk Level stocks Bonds Cash / Alternatives
conservative 20% 60% 20%
Balanced 50% 40% 10%
Aggressive 80% 15% 5%

The power of Research: Making Smarter⁤ Choices Before You Buy

Before making any investment, digging deep​ into the facts and figures can save you from costly mistakes down⁤ the road. It’s not just about reading the ⁣first article you find or trusting⁤ a flashy ad; it’s about understanding ⁣ what lies beneath the surface. Research empowers you to spot opportunities others might overlook, compare​ options side-by-side, and anticipate potential risks ​with a clearer head. When you commit to this practice, you’re essentially sharpening your ​decision-making skills, which is invaluable in the fast-paced world of ‌investing.

Here are ‌some quick research hacks to⁣ get you started:

  • Compare key metrics like fees, returns, and risks before picking assets.
  • Read ​user reviews and⁤ expert opinions ‌from ​multiple sources.
  • Track historical performance​ but‍ don’t rely ‌on it exclusively.
  • Check‌ the ⁢credibility of ⁣financial advisors or platforms you’re considering.
  • Use tools like screening websites and ‌calculators to visualize potential outcomes.
Research Aspect Why It Matters Quick‌ Tip
fees High fees can⁣ eat into your returns over time Look for obvious fee structures
Risk Level Understanding risk helps you match⁣ investments to your goals Use risk assessment tools
Historical Returns Shows track record but not‌ guaranteed future gains Compare against benchmarks

Avoiding Common Pitfalls That Can Tank Your Returns

One of the biggest traps new investors fall ⁤into​ is chasing hot tips or trying​ to time the market. While it might feel exciting⁢ to jump on the latest trend or avoid downturns, this approach often leads to buying high and selling low—the exact opposite of what you want for growing your money. Instead, stick to a well-thought-out plan‍ and focus on long-term goals. Remember, consistent contributions and patience almost always trump emotional decision-making. Avoid getting swept up in the noise and keep your eyes ​on the bigger financial picture.

Another ⁤common mistake is‌ neglecting ​diversification.putting all your eggs ​in one basket,⁤ whether it’s a single stock or sector, can be risky. Spreading your investments across different asset classes helps cushion against volatility and downturns in any one‍ area. Here’s ‌a quick example of diversifying your portfolio smartly:

Asset Class Suggested Allocation Risk Level
Stocks 50% High
Bonds 30% Moderate
Real estate 15% Moderate
Cash/Cash Equivalents 5% Low

Mixing ⁣it up like this ⁤not only helps manage risk ‍but also positions you to benefit from different market conditions. Smart investing is less about big wins overnight and more ⁣about steady, thoughtful moves‌ that protect your hard-earned money over time.

using⁣ Tech Tools to Stay ⁣Ahead and ‍Grow Your Investments Faster

Harnessing the power of technology can transform ⁢the⁢ way you invest, making it easier and faster​ to spot opportunities and manage your portfolio effectively. From intuitive apps that analyze market trends in real-time to AI-driven platforms offering personalized advice, the digital landscape offers‍ tools designed to keep you a step ahead. imagine having⁢ alerts customized ‍to your risk preferences or​ automated rebalancing strategies that work ​while you sleep—these innovations are no longer just for Wall Street pros, ⁢but for everyday investors like you.

Consider incorporating these tech tools into your investing routine:

  • Robo-advisors: ⁢ Automated platforms that create and manage your investment portfolio efficiently.
  • Stock screeners: Filter stocks based on specific criteria like P/E ratio,dividend yield,or market cap.
  • Portfolio trackers: Visualize your holdings with⁢ easy-to-understand graphs and performance metrics.
  • News aggregators: Stay updated with curated financial news that impacts your investments.
Tool Type Benefit Ideal ‍For
Robo-advisors Hands-free portfolio ⁤management Beginners and busy investors
Stock screeners Quick, tailored stock discovery Active⁣ traders
Portfolio Trackers Visual‍ performance insights Long-term investors
News Aggregators Instant access to market ‌news All investors

Q&A:​ Smart Investing Tips You​ Can Start Using Today!

Q: I’m new to investing—where should I⁣ even start?
A: Great question! The ⁢best place to start​ is by getting clear on your goals. Are you saving for​ retirement, a ⁤house, or just growing your money? Once you know your ​“why,” you can figure out‌ the appropriate risk level and investment type. Also, make sure you have an emergency fund in place before diving into investing—that way, you won’t need⁢ to sell investments in a ‌pinch.

Q: how much money do I need to start investing?
A: the cool thing about today’s investing⁣ world is that you don’t need a ton of cash ‍to get going. Thanks to‍ apps and platforms⁢ with no minimums and fractional shares, you can start with even $50. The key is consistency—contribute regularly, even if it’s a small amount.

Q: Should I‍ try picking individual stocks or just stick to funds?
A: Unless⁤ you’re ready‌ to spend⁣ a bunch of time researching companies, it’s usually smarter to start with ​low-cost index funds or ETFs.Thay give you instant ​diversification and typically lower risk. ​If you want to dabble in stocks later,go for it—but keep most⁤ of your money in diversified funds.

Q: How crucial is ⁢diversification, really?
A: Super important! diversification basically means “don’t put all ⁣your eggs in one ⁤basket.” Spreading ⁢your‍ money across different assets reduces the‍ impact if ​one investment tanks. Think of it ⁣like building ‌a solid team—you want players covering⁣ different positions.

Q: What’s the deal with fees—how ‍much should⁤ I worry ⁢about them?
⁣
A: Fees might sound boring, but they can seriously eat into your returns over time. Try to ⁤keep your costs low by choosing ⁤funds with low expense ratios and avoiding high commission platforms. Over years, small fee differences add up to big savings.

Q: Is​ timing the market a good idea?
A: Nope! Trying to buy low and sell high⁤ sounds great in theory, but in reality,⁣ it’s super tough—even experts get it wrong. Instead, focus on time ‌in the⁣ market, ​not timing the market. Consistent ⁣investing over long periods usually wins out.

Q: How frequently​ enough should ⁢I check or adjust my investments?
A: Set ⁢it and forget it—kind of! Checking in ‌once or twice ‍a year to rebalance your portfolio (making sure your allocation matches your goals) is good.Avoid ‍looking too often because short-term market moves can make‍ you⁢ freak out and make poor decisions.

Q:⁤ Any last pro tips for beginner investors?
A: Yup!‌ Be patient,⁤ keep learning, and don’t let ‌emotions ⁣drive decisions. The ⁤market will have ups and downs, but sticking to a smart plan is the key to⁣ building wealth over time.⁢ And remember,it’s totally okay to ask for help from a‌ financial advisor⁤ if you ‌feel ⁣overwhelmed.
